WebSep 18, 2024 · 3. Circuit breaker. The circuit breaker is the most critical part of a gas insulated substation system. The circuit breaker in a gas insulated system is metal-clad and utilises SF6 gas, both for insulation and fault interruption. The SF6 gas pressure in a circuit breaker is around 0.65 MPa.
